Geo-Technology Associates, Inc. (GTA) is seeking anexceptionalConstruction Materials Testing Project Manager (CMT PM)to join our dynamic team inCharlotte, North Carolina. As a CMT PM, you'll take charge of supervising Construction Field Technicians in the field, conducting crucial observations and testing related toSpecial Inspections during site work and building construction. Your role will involve compiling comprehensive reports and overseeing field and laboratory testing of soils, concrete, asphalt, aggregates, and structural steel. Collaborating closely with technical experts, you'll coordinate personnel and equipment while liaising with clients, project managers, subcontractors, and management entities to address challenges swiftly and ensure project requirements are meticulously fulfilled.
